Giovanni Malagò Faces Serie A Backlash Over Roberto Mancini’s National Team Appointment
Serie A club presidents voiced strong anger after FIGC president Giovanni Malagò announced former national coach Roberto Mancini as Italy’s new head coach. Club leaders claimed the decision was made without consultation, describing it as a “National team of Rome North” driven by cronyism. Some clubs had previously discussed appointing Antonio Conte and even considered challenging Malagò’s authority, but the appointment proceeded unilaterally. The discontent highlights a power struggle within Italian football, with senior clubs accusing Malagò of ignoring their influence and seeking to control the national team agenda for the next four‑year cycle.
